The Vietnamese word "thắm" is an adjective that can mean "deep," "gorgeous," or "warm" depending on the context. Let’s break it down to help you understand how to use it effectively.

Basic Meaning:
  1. Deep: When describing colors, "thắm" refers to a rich, intense shade. For example, a "màu đỏ thắm" means a deep, vibrant red.
  2. Gorgeous: It can also describe something that is beautiful or stunning, often used in a poetic sense.
  3. Warm: In some contexts, "thắm" can convey a sense of warmth, especially in emotional expressions or atmospheres.
Usage Instructions:
  • "Thắm" is often used with nouns to describe them. For example, when you want to say "deep blue," you would say "xanh thắm."
  • It can also be used in more abstract contexts, such as emotions or relationships, to convey depth or beauty.
Examples:
  1. Color: "Bức tranh màu xanh thắm." (The painting has a deep blue color.)
  2. Beauty: " ấy có vẻ đẹp thắm." (She has a gorgeous beauty.)
  3. Emotion: "Tình yêu thắm thiết." (A warm, deep love.)
Advanced Usage:
  • In poetry or literature, "thắm" is often used to evoke feelings or create vivid images. For instance, a poet might describe a sunset as "ánh hoàng hôn thắm đẹp" (gorgeous deep sunset).
  • It can also imply a sense of nostalgia or a profound connection to something, like "kỷ niệm thắm thiết" (deep memories).
Word Variants:
  • Thắm thiết: This phrase means "deep" or "intimate," often used to describe close relationships or connections.
  • Thắm màu: This phrase can be used to refer to colors that are vibrant or rich.
Different Meanings:

While "thắm" primarily relates to depth, beauty, and warmth, context matters. It’s essential to consider what you are describing to choose the right nuance.

Synonyms:
  • Sâu: This means "deep." It is often used for physical depth or figurative depth, such as deep understanding.
  • Đẹp: This means "beautiful." It can be used in a more general sense to describe beauty without the specific richness of "thắm."
  • Nồng: This means "warm" or "rich" in flavor, often used in culinary contexts.
